Some recommended foods to include in a stage 2 baby food list are mashed fruits like bananas and avocados, cooked and pureed vegetables like sweet potatoes and carrots, soft cooked grains like rice and oatmeal, and finely chopped or ground meats like chicken and turkey. These foods provide essential nutrients for a growing baby and help introduce them to a variety of flavors and textures.

What are some recommended options for introducing 2nd stage baby foods to infants transitioning from purees to more textured foods?

Some recommended options for introducing 2nd stage baby foods to infants transitioning from purees to more textured foods include mashed fruits and vegetables, soft cooked grains like rice or quinoa, finely chopped or shredded meats, and small pieces of soft fruits or cooked vegetables. It's important to gradually increase the texture and size of the food to help babies adjust to chewing and swallowing.


What are some recommended recipes for stage 2 baby puree that are nutritious and easy to prepare?

Some recommended recipes for stage 2 baby puree that are nutritious and easy to prepare include sweet potato and apple puree, avocado and banana puree, and carrot and pear puree. These recipes provide a good balance of vitamins and minerals for your baby's development.

What are some important considerations when introducing first solid foods for a baby?

When introducing first solid foods to a baby, important considerations include the baby's age and readiness, choosing appropriate foods, introducing one new food at a time, watching for signs of allergies, and ensuring the food is prepared safely. It is also important to consult with a pediatrician for guidance and to follow recommended feeding guidelines.


Is it safe to introduce solid foods to my baby at 3 months of age?

No, it is not safe to introduce solid foods to a baby at 3 months of age. It is recommended to wait until around 6 months of age to start introducing solid foods to ensure the baby's digestive system is ready.
